i bought a really ripe mango at the store yesterday, and i can't wait to eat it! do you cut it like you would a pear or pineapple (i.e. four big cuts around the sides vertically, leaving the harder core part in the center)? and then how do i remove the skin once i've done that?
i used to use the cube method, but now i just slice one side off with the skin on (i think that they are hard to cut once the skin is off since they are slippery), cut it into strips or sections, THEN slice the skin off once they are in smaller pieces. i slice one up almost every morning. they are my absolute favorite.
